React element type in typescript

WebApr 6, 2024 · 6. forwardRef() in TypeScript. React forwardRef() in TypeScript is a bit trickier because you need to specify the type arguments of useRef() in the parent component … WebApr 14, 2024 · まずStorybookの生成コマンドを叩くと下記のエラーが表示されました。. TypeError: Invalid Version: null. 直接関係があるissueではないように思うけど、下記のissueを参考にしました。. TypeScriptのバージョンが影響することもあるのかとまずはTypeScriptをアップデートし ...

JSX.Element vs ReactElement vs ReactNode - DEV Community

WebFor React, intrinsic elements are emitted as strings (React.createElement("div")), whereas a component you’ve created is not (React.createElement(MyComponent)). The types of the … WebJan 18, 2024 · You can create functional components in TypeScript just like you would in JavaScript. The main difference is the FC interface, which stands for Function Component. We use this to tell TypeScript that this is a React function component and not just a … sickly hecks https://tumblebunnies.net

TypeScript - Slate - slatejs.org

Web我试图在一个使用React Hooks和Styled组件的React Typescript项目中创建一个自定义按钮组件。 // Button.tsx import React, { MouseEvent } from "react"; import styled from "styled … WebCasting is the process of overriding a type. Casting with as A straightforward way to cast a variable is using the as keyword, which will directly change the type of the given variable. Example Get your own TypeScript Server let x: unknown = 'hello'; console.log( (x as string).length); Try it Yourself » WebNov 24, 2024 · TypeScript’s Definitely Typed library include the React.FunctionComponent (or React.FC for short) that you can use to type React function components. You can combine the type Props and the React.FC type to create a type-safe function component with props as follows: type Props = { title: string } const App: React.FC = ( {title}) … sickly headache nhs

TypeScript Object Types - W3School

Category:React forwardRef(): How to Pass Refs to Child Components

Tags:React element type in typescript

React element type in typescript

Using TypeScript · React Native

WebDec 21, 2024 · Using TypeScript with React allows you to develop strongly-typed components that have identifiable props and state objects, which will ensure any usages … WebApr 10, 2024 · デ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エンドに一歩近づこう. こんにちは。. ひらやま( @rhirayamaaan )です。. 先日とあるツイートを見かけ、つい反応してしまいました。. これはReactコンポーネントを作る時に最低限必要なTypeScriptの知識を ...

React element type in typescript

Did you know?

WebCheatsheets for experienced React developers getting started with TypeScript - GitHub - dipak2811/react-cheatsheet: Cheatsheets for experienced React developers getting … WebEvent that occurs when elements gets or loses focus. FormEvent: Event that occurs whenever a form or form element gets/loses focus, a form element value is changed or …

WebApr 12, 2024 · To create a new React app with TypeScript, you can use the create-react-app CLI tool. Open a terminal window and run the following command: npx create-react-app … WebDefining Custom Elements Applying Custom Formatting Executing Commands Saving to a Database Using the Bundled Source Concepts Interfaces Nodes Locations Transforms Operations Commands Editor Plugins Rendering Serializing Normalizing TypeScript Migrating API Transforms Node Types Location Types Operation Scrubber Libraries Slate …

WebJan 17, 2024 · Referencing React Typings. To access React TypeScript typings, ensure your TypeScript-based React project has the @types/react installed: 1 npm install … WebApr 11, 2024 · Here's some more detailed information on how to convert JavaScript files to TypeScript: Rename .js files to .tsx or .ts: This is a simple step that you can do to indicate to TypeScript that the file contains TypeScript code. If the file contains JSX code, use the .tsx extension. Otherwise, use the .ts extension.

WebJul 30, 2024 · To use useRef with TypeScript, it is actually pretty easy, all you need to do is provide the type that you want to the function via open and closed chevrons like you would with other React hooks like so: const myRef = useRef (0). Here is an example of how to use useRef with TypeScript:

WebTS2339: Property 'leafletElement' does not exist on type 'ForwardRefExoticComponent>'. I have been … the photo nasa took on january 15th 2009WebFeb 14, 2024 · Both types are the result of React.createElement () / jsx () function call. They are both objects with: type props key a couple of other "hidden" properties, like ref, $$typeof, etc ReactElement ReactElement type is the most basic of all. It's even defined in React source code using flow! sickly husband’s contractual wife mangaWebApr 11, 2024 · Here's some more detailed information on how to convert JavaScript files to TypeScript: Rename .js files to .tsx or .ts: This is a simple step that you can do to indicate … the photo meaningWeb1 day ago · I can't seem to find a proper TypeScript type for form elements, which may have .form.labels.value.disabled etc. ... React with Typescript - problem with typing ChangeEvent. Load 7 more related questions Show fewer related questions Sorted by: Reset to default ... sickly husband\\u0027s contractual wife light novelWebOct 12, 2024 · In those cases, you don't need to do anything yourself. For example, the following is perfectly valid TypeScript, and works as you would want: const [greeting, setGreeting] = useState('Hello World'); TypeScript will understand that greeting is supposed to be a string, and will also assign the right type to setGreeting as a result. the photonamaWebTypeScript PR merged to allow components to return anything renderable (raw strings, numbers, promises for RSC), instead of just JSX.Element and null. github. comments … sickly husband\\u0027s contractual wife chapter 79WebJul 19, 2024 · 按@ types 安装 react以后运行, 出现错误 (2632,14): error TS2300: Duplicate identifier 'Element'. 我把@types/react-dom和@types/react-router里的node_modules删除后就不报错了 (这两个node_modules里又重复引用了@types/react) 看上去是重复依赖的问题,请问有什么配置的方法解决吗, ts.config如下: { sickly hoodie